A robust plant protein adhesive was prepared by fabricating a bi‐continuous organic–inorganic hybrid structure. Compared with traditional organic–inorganic hybrid adhesives, the addition amount of inorganic phase is increased from 0.2%–3.0% to 50%, and the strength and toughness are increased by 6 and 121 times, respectively.

Combustion Characteristics of Combustion Chamber Using Compost as a Fuel
AbstractThe aim of the present study is to develop the biomass furnace combustor which can effectively use the compost as a fuel. Here, the compost which is made from pig's waste and has the calorific value of 2000kcal/kg, is employed here.
